Nala Renewables are looking for a Procurement Manager to come and join the team. This will be the first hire within the procurement department and will be reporting directly into the Head of Procurement. This opportunity is based out of the headquarters in London.
This role will be ensuring that projects meet financial requirements, technical specifications, and project timelines. The Procurement Manager will collaborate with internal teams, suppliers, and external stakeholders to secure the correct supplies for renewable energy projects to maintain compliance, reliability, and profitability. This role provides an opportunity to grow the expertise of the EPC function in multiple jurisdictions to support Nala Renewables' ambition as a global IPP.
I am looking for candidates with:
· 5+ years of experience in supply chain, purchasing, logistics in the renewable energy industry (ideally solar and BESS, wind would also be advantageous)
· Proven track record of reducing costs and supply time for large-scale renewable energy projects (solar, Onshore Wind, BESS or hybrid).
· Excellent project management and organisational skills
· Strong negotiation and communication abilities for stakeholder engagement
· Management of project documentation, including reports, protocols, and technical specifications
